NOIR CITY 13: SUSPICION / THE BIGAMIST
Saturday, January 17: Matinee: Joan Fontaine Tribute
The price of admission gets you into the afternoon double bill.
1:30 SUSPICION (1941, RKO Radio Pictures. 99 min.)
Scr. Samson Raphaelson. Dir. Alfred Hitchcock.
Joan Fontaine won a Best Actress Oscar for her portrayal of spinsterish Lina McLaidlaw, who, despite the warnings of friends and family, marries handsome rogue Johnnie Aysgarth (Cary Grant) . . . only to grow increasingly suspicious that Johnnie is only after her money and will stop at nothing, even murder, to get it.
3:30 THE BIGAMIST (1953, The Filmakers. 79 min.)
Scr. Collier Young. Dir. Ida Lupino.
A San Francisco couple wants to bolster their unfulfilled marriage by adopting a child. But when a social worker checks the husband's background, he learns there's a second wife in L.A.! This remarkable film uses a familiar noir framework to turn the genre's tropes inside out, flipping gender roles and dissecting the pitfalls of buying into the matrimonial myth of "happily ever after."
